Young World Champion Aims for the Olympics

Monday, June 20, 2022

Young lifter Luluk Diana Tria Wijayana wins three gold medals in the 2022 Youth Weightlifting World Championships. She is now aiming for the 2024 Paris Olympics.

Luluk Diana when competing in the 49-kilogram category with 75 kilograms in snatch lift and 170 kilograms of total weight, during the 2022 IWF Youth World Championships in Leon, Guonojuoto, Mexico, June 14. iwf.sport . tempo : 176586209193.

LULUK Diana Tri Wijayana let out a shout to make herself more relaxed when she was about to finish the clean and jerk lift. After a smooth clean—lifting the barbell to shoulders in a squat position—she was further encouraged by guidance from her coach. “Be calm, hold, and raise it high,” said Coach Samsuri from the side of the stage.
